Ejector Pump Installation in Tuscaloosa, AL

Ejector pump installation is a service that helps property owners manage wastewater and sewage that cannot flow naturally due to elevation differences or plumbing constraints. This system is commonly used in basement bathrooms, laundry rooms, or additions where traditional gravity drainage isn't possible. The installation process involves setting up a pump and associated piping to reliably move wastewater to the main sewer line or septic system, ensuring proper sanitation and preventing backups. Homeowners typically request this service when remodeling, finishing a basement, or addressing drainage issues that require elevating waste away from lower-lying areas.

Before requesting ejector pump installation, property owners should understand the specific requirements of their project, including the location of existing plumbing, the volume of wastewater generated, and the space available for equipment. It’s also important to consider the power supply and access for maintenance. Proper assessment ensures the system is correctly sized and positioned for reliable operation. Consulting with experienced professionals can help clarify these details and ensure the installation meets the property's needs effectively.

Ejector Pump Installation Questions

What is an ejector pump used for? An ejector pump helps remove wastewater from basement bathrooms or laundry areas when gravity drainage isn't possible.

How do I know if my property needs an ejector pump? Signs include slow drainage, foul odors, or backups in basement plumbing fixtures.

What types of projects typically require ejector pump installation? Ejector pumps are commonly installed in homes with below-grade bathrooms or additional plumbing fixtures in basements.

What should property owners consider before installing an ejector pump? It's important to evaluate the plumbing layout and ensure proper venting and electrical connections for reliable operation.
